summaryrefslogtreecommitdiff
authorXindong Xu <xindong.xu@amlogic.com>2020-11-16 08:24:52 (GMT)
committer Xindong Xu <xindong.xu@amlogic.com>2020-11-16 08:24:56 (GMT)
commitddbb3a71a6d67935d057f44025089d58c1e2dcd1 (patch)
treeebaf36ca9f736d174d1ceec96c9c665e68dbb172
parentcb9dd9ffe5fa0c145f00ee1e41b50f6e16684c0e (diff)
downloadcommon-ddbb3a71a6d67935d057f44025089d58c1e2dcd1.zip
common-ddbb3a71a6d67935d057f44025089d58c1e2dcd1.tar.gz
common-ddbb3a71a6d67935d057f44025089d58c1e2dcd1.tar.bz2
build: delete useless code [1/2]
PD#SWPL-36508 Problem: don't need to build bootloader inside android Solution: delete useless code Verify: newton Change-Id: I88c68ff866f23b92b0249fb6d0c865b5def2f885 Signed-off-by: Xindong Xu <xindong.xu@amlogic.com>
Diffstat
-rw-r--r--factory.mk59
1 files changed, 0 insertions, 59 deletions
diff --git a/factory.mk b/factory.mk
index e723c4d..9b5cf6b 100644
--- a/factory.mk
+++ b/factory.mk
@@ -263,68 +263,9 @@ BOOTLOADER_DIR := ~/bootloader/uboot-repo
endif
endif
-ifeq ($(PRODUCT_GOOGLEREF_SECURE_BOOT),true)
-ifeq ($(TARGET_DEVICE),sabrina)
-UBOOT_BUILD_PARAM := "sm1_sabrina_v1 --bl32 $(BOOTLOADER_DIR)/bl32/bin/g12a/bl32.img --avb2"
-else
-ifneq (,$(filter $(TARGET_DEVICE),deadpool adt3))
-UBOOT_BUILD_PARAM := "g12a_deadpool_v1 --bl32 $(ANDROID_HOME_DIR)/vendor/amlogic/common/tdk/secureos/g12a/bl32.img --avb2"
-endif
-endif
-ifeq ($(TARGET_DEVICE),newton)
-UBOOT_BUILD_PARAM := "sm1_ac214_v1 --bl32 $(ANDROID_HOME_DIR)/vendor/amlogic/common/tdk/secureos/g12a/bl32.img --avb2 CONFIG_AVB2_KPUB_DEFAULT_VENDOR=1"
-endif
-UBOOT_TOOLCHAIN_PATH := $(ANDROID_HOME_DIR)/vendor/amlogic/common/tools/Sourcery_G++_Lite/bin/:$(ANDROID_HOME_DIR)/vendor/amlogic/common/tools/gcc_none-elf_linux/bin/
-ifeq ($(PRODUCT_BUILD_AML_BOOTLOADER),true)
-$(INSTALLED_AMLOGIC_BOOTLOADER_TARGET):
-ifneq ($(wildcard ~/bootloader/.* bootloader/uboot-repo/*),)
- echo cd $(BOOTLOADER_DIR) && pwd && \
- PATH=$(UBOOT_TOOLCHAIN_PATH)/:$$(cd ./$(TARGET_HOST_TOOL_PATH); pwd):$$PATH \
- device/amlogic/common/scripts/build_uboot.sh $(BOOTLOADER_DIR) $(UBOOT_TOOLCHAIN_PATH) $(UBOOT_BUILD_PARAM)
- echo cd $(ANDROID_HOME_DIR)
-
- cp $(ANDROID_HOME_DIR)/bootloader/uboot-repo/fip/_tmp/bl2_new.bin $(TARGET_DEVICE_DIR)/prebuilt/bootloader/
- cp $(ANDROID_HOME_DIR)/bootloader/uboot-repo/fip/_tmp/bl30_new.bin $(TARGET_DEVICE_DIR)/prebuilt/bootloader/
- cp $(ANDROID_HOME_DIR)/bootloader/uboot-repo/fip/_tmp/bl31.img $(TARGET_DEVICE_DIR)/prebuilt/bootloader/
- cp $(ANDROID_HOME_DIR)/bootloader/uboot-repo/fip/_tmp/bl32.img $(TARGET_DEVICE_DIR)/prebuilt/bootloader/
- cp $(ANDROID_HOME_DIR)/bootloader/uboot-repo/fip/_tmp/bl33.bin $(TARGET_DEVICE_DIR)/prebuilt/bootloader/
-
- # ================ compress bl33 ================
- $(TARGET_DEVICE_DIR)/tools/aml_encrypt_g12a --bl3sig --input $(TARGET_DEVICE_DIR)/prebuilt/bootloader/bl33.bin --output $(PRODUCT_OUT)/bl33.bin.lz4.org --compress lz4 --level v3 --type bl33
- #get LZ4 format bl33 image from bl33.bin.enc with offset 0x720
- dd if=$(PRODUCT_OUT)/bl33.bin.lz4.org of=$(PRODUCT_OUT)/bl33.bin.lz4 bs=1 skip=1824 >& /dev/null
- # ===============================================
-
- echo "****** bash $(ANDROID_HOME_DIR)/$(PRODUCT_GOOGLEREF_SECURE_BOOT_TOOL)"
-
- PATH=$(UBOOT_TOOLCHAIN_PATH):$$PATH && bash $(ANDROID_HOME_DIR)/$(PRODUCT_GOOGLEREF_SECURE_BOOT_TOOL) $(ANDROID_HOME_DIR)
- cp $(TARGET_DEVICE_DIR)/prebuilt/bootloader/u-boot.bin.signed $(TARGET_DEVICE_DIR)/bootloader.img
- cp $(TARGET_DEVICE_DIR)/prebuilt/bootloader/u-boot.bin $(TARGET_DEVICE_DIR)/bootloader_unsign.img
-
- PATH=$(UBOOT_TOOLCHAIN_PATH)/:$$(cd ./$(TARGET_HOST_TOOL_PATH); pwd):$$PATH && \
- bash $(ANDROID_HOME_DIR)/device/amlogic/common/get_bootloader_version.sh $(BOOTLOADER_DIR) $(TARGET_DEVICE_DIR)
-endif
-else
-$(INSTALLED_AMLOGIC_BOOTLOADER_TARGET): $(BOOTLOADER_INPUT)
-endif
- mkdir -p $(PRODUCT_OUT)/upgrade/
- cp $(BOOTLOADER_INPUT) $(PRODUCT_OUT)/bootloader.img
- cp $(BOOTLOADER_INPUT) $(PRODUCT_OUT)/upgrade/bootloader.img.encrypt
- cp $(TARGET_DEVICE_DIR)/prebuilt/bootloader/u-boot.bin.usb.bl2.signed $(PRODUCT_OUT)/upgrade/
- cp $(TARGET_DEVICE_DIR)/prebuilt/bootloader/u-boot.bin.usb.tpl.signed $(PRODUCT_OUT)/upgrade/
- cp $(TARGET_DEVICE_DIR)/prebuilt/bootloader/u-boot.bin.sd.signed $(PRODUCT_OUT)/upgrade/
-
- cp $(TARGET_DEVICE_DIR)/bootloader_unsign.img $(PRODUCT_OUT)/upgrade/bootloader.img
- cp $(TARGET_DEVICE_DIR)/prebuilt/bootloader/u-boot.bin.usb.bl2 $(PRODUCT_OUT)/upgrade/
- cp $(TARGET_DEVICE_DIR)/prebuilt/bootloader/u-boot.bin.usb.tpl $(PRODUCT_OUT)/upgrade/
- cp $(TARGET_DEVICE_DIR)/prebuilt/bootloader/u-boot.bin.sd $(PRODUCT_OUT)/upgrade/
-
- @echo "make secure bootloader.img: bootloader installed end"
-else
$(INSTALLED_AMLOGIC_BOOTLOADER_TARGET) : $(BOOTLOADER_INPUT)
$(hide) cp $< $@
@echo "make $@: bootloader installed end"
-endif
$(call dist-for-goals, droidcore, $(INSTALLED_AMLOGIC_BOOTLOADER_TARGET))